

Whereas the New England Patriots loved their bye week, the Denver Broncos climbed again on prime within the AFC standings.
Denver defeated the Las Vegas Raiders in Week 14 to enhance to 11-2 this season. New England additionally has an 11-2 document, however the Broncos will clinch any tiebreaker as a consequence of their higher document towards frequent opponents. The Patriots fell to the Raiders in Week 1.
The battle for the No. 1 seed is not the one entertaining AFC storyline with 4 weeks left within the common season. The Pittsburgh Steelers surprised Lamar Jackson and the Baltimore Ravens to take the highest spot within the AFC North and ship Baltimore down a number of spots within the AFC standings. The Indianapolis Colts (8-5) misplaced quarterback Daniel Jones to an Achilles tear whereas falling to the Jacksonville Jaguars (9-4), who at present have the No. 3 seed. The Buffalo Payments (9-4) outlasted the Joe Burrow-led Cincinnati Bengals (4-9) throughout an exhilarating showdown within the snow.

Race for the AFC East
The Patriots’ lead over the Payments is down to 2 video games after Buffalo defeated Cincinnati Sunday. Their “magic number” to win the AFC East is three, that means any mixture of three Patriots wins/Payments losses will clinch the division for New England.
If it comes all the way down to a tiebreaker, the Patriots are in an awesome spot. After head-to-head matchup (New England beat Buffalo in Week 5), the second tiebreaker for divisional opponents is in-division document. The Patriots are at present 3-0 towards the AFC East, whereas Buffalo is 2-2.
Three of the Patriots’ subsequent 4 video games are towards AFC East rivals. This is a have a look at the remaining schedules for New England and Buffalo:
- Patriots: vs. Payments, at Ravens, at Jets, vs. Dolphins
- Payments: vs. Patriots, at Browns, vs. Eagles, vs. Jets
